What the tribunal said
The tribunal determined the open market rent at £3,450 per month based on its own expert knowledge and comparable evidence submitted. The rent takes into account the property's configuration, specification, and condition. The tribunal declined to postpone the effective date because the tenant failed to provide sufficient evidence of undue hardship.
The property
The tenant reported worn and fraying carpets, peeling kitchen laminate with mismatched replacement unit doors, electrical fault with downlights in an en-suite, damaged window blinds, and past water leak damage to the kitchen floor. The concierge service was withdrawn in 2022. The tenant replaced a damaged bed and sofa.
